The transition from childhood to becoming a teen is difficult. School work gets harder, work loads get heavier, and you go through physical, mental, and emotional changes. My personal experience was that I was stressed. Work was hard and my grades dropped. I started to struggle to find things that I enjoyed. But the obstacle that had the biggest impact on me was the world-wide pandemic - Covid 19. By the end of my 6th grade year, my mother chose to take me out in-person learning and transition me to online education. The hardest part of the transition was communication. Online schooling was new to me. As a result, it was difficult for the teachers as well as students and parents to communicate with one another. My biggest challenge was being able to talk with my friends.

The year that I started my online education was my first year attending middle school and was also a new school for me. I had to make new friends and meet new teachers. Making friends was not a problem for me because everyone was amiable and I fit in easily. The challenge was keeping those connections during the pandemic when I was taking online classes for the end of 6th grade year and my entire 7th grade year. I did not have my own phone. Unable to socialize with my friends made my days monotonous and boring sometimes. I did not feel like doing school work because I was at home. I lived an isolated lifestyle for over a year, but I am glad that I kept pushing forward.

I know you have heard of sayings like, “there’s a light at the end of the tunnel” or “there is a silver lining.” These may seem cliche, but they are true. I have always heard that “God has a greater plan for you”.Have faith in God. Through all of the struggles that you may face, just know that there is a light at the end of the tunnel and that there is a purpose for the path that you are on. When it is over, look back, reflect, and be proud that you persevered through it all.
